Born in Kenya of Indian heritage, Brendan Fernandes immigrated to Canada in the 1990s. He com- pleted the Independent Study Program of the Whitney Museum of American Art (2007) and earned his MFA (2005) from The University of Western Ontario and his BFA (2002) from York University in Canada. He has exhibited internationally, including the Third Guangzhou Triennial, Guangzhou, China (2008) and the Western New York Biennial through the Albright-Knox Art Gallery in Buffalo, NY (2007). Fernandes has participated in numerous residency programs including the Canada Council for the Arts Interna- tional Residency in Trinidad and Tobago (2006), the Lower Manhattan Cultural Council’s Work Space (2008) and Swing Space (2009) programs, Emerge 10 at Aljira: A Center for Contemporary Art, Newark, NJ (2008), the AIM Program at the Bronx Museum (2009), the New Work Residency at Harvestwork, NY (2009), and an invitation to the Gyeonggi Creation Center at the Gyeonggi Museum of Modern Art, Korea. He has held the position of Artist in Residence at The School of Visual Arts, New York, in the grad- uate program for computer arts (2008) and is the a current recipient of a New Commissions Project through Art in General, NY (2010). He is based between Toronto and New York. His work is represented by Diaz Contemporary, Toronto.
